Web29 dec. 2024 · Typically performed in a healthcare setting, the Z-track method involves pulling the skin and subcutaneous tissue to the side of the injection site before inserting the needle. Once the needle is removed, the tissue is released. This creates a zigzag pattern or Z track of the needle path. As a result, the medication is less likely to track ... WebStretch the skin flat (Z-tracking if applicable) Inject the needle to the hub at a 90-degree angle. Do not aspirate or drawback as this can increase pain and discomfort in children. Inject the medication at a slow and steady pace. Remove the needle and apply a cotton ball. Place the needle in a sharps container.
